Crossword Answer definitions
EMPIRE adjective- (furniture) Following or imitating a style popular during the First French Empire (1804–1814).
- (of wine) Produced in a dependency of the British Empire or Commonwealth of Nations.
- A political unit, typically having an extensive territory or comprising a number of territories or nations (especially one comprising one or more kingdoms) and ruled by a single supreme authority.
- A political unit ruled by an emperor or empress.
- A group of states or other territories that owe allegiance to a foreign power.
- An expansive and powerful enterprise under the control of one person or group.
- (Absolute) control, dominion, sway.
